Below are a selection of pictures of how the new scrape area of the project is looking now most of the excavation has been completed. The final touches to the bunding and pools are expected to be completed by Friday this week.
Once the landscaping works have been completed the next stages of the project are to install a new hide for visitors to be able to watch the wildlife from and to install a large section of boardwalk to open up the wetland area for access on a permanent basis. The boardwalk section will offer views of the waterfall on the River Arun as well as provide a link back to the new surfaced path at the top of the field.
